| 
      
      
      From: <cl...@us...> - 2003-11-20 05:19:17
      
     | 
| Update of /cvsroot/phpicalendar/phpicalendar
In directory sc8-pr-cvs1:/tmp/cvs-serv32703
Modified Files:
	day.php month.php week.php 
Log Message:
Added URL support to popup, re-wrote event.php for less code.
Index: day.php
===================================================================
RCS file: /cvsroot/phpicalendar/phpicalendar/day.php,v
retrieving revision 1.101
retrieving revision 1.102
diff -C2 -d -r1.101 -r1.102
*** day.php	19 Nov 2003 07:54:09 -0000	1.101
--- day.php	20 Nov 2003 05:18:38 -0000	1.102
***************
*** 92,107 ****
  						 $event_calno  = $allday['calnumber'];
  						 $event_calna  = $allday['calname'];
  						 if ($event_calno < 1) $event_calno=1;
  						 if ($event_calno > 7) $event_calno=7;
  						 echo '<td valign="top" align="center" class="eventbg_'.$event_calno.'">';
! 						 openevent("$event_calna",
! 							   "",
! 							   "",
! 							   $allday,
! 							   0,
! 							   "",
! 							   '<font color="#ffffff"><i>',
! 							   "</i></font>",
! 							   "psf");
  						 echo "</td>\n</tr>\n";
  					   }
--- 92,100 ----
  						 $event_calno  = $allday['calnumber'];
  						 $event_calna  = $allday['calname'];
+ 						 $event_url	   = $allday['url'];
  						 if ($event_calno < 1) $event_calno=1;
  						 if ($event_calno > 7) $event_calno=7;
  						 echo '<td valign="top" align="center" class="eventbg_'.$event_calno.'">';
! 						 openevent($event_calna, '', '', $allday, 0, '', '<font color="#ffffff"><i>', '</i></font>', 'psf', $url);
  						 echo "</td>\n</tr>\n";
  					   }
***************
*** 254,267 ****
  												  echo '<tr>'."\n";
  												  echo '<td class="eventbg_'.$event_calno.'">';
! 												  $event_calna = $this_time_arr[($event_length[$i]['key'])]['calname'];
! 										  		  openevent("$event_calna",
! 												  "$event_start",
! 												  "$event_end",
! 												  $this_time_arr[($event_length[$i]['key'])],
! 												  "",
! 												  0,
! 												  "<font class=\"eventfont\">",
! 												  "</font>",
! 												  "psf");
  												  echo '</td></tr>'."\n";
  												  echo '</table>'."\n";
--- 247,253 ----
  												  echo '<tr>'."\n";
  												  echo '<td class="eventbg_'.$event_calno.'">';
! 												  $event_calna 	= $this_time_arr[($event_length[$i]['key'])]['calname'];
! 												  $event_url 	= $this_time_arr[($event_length[$i]['key'])]['url'];
! 										  		  openevent($event_calna, $event_start, $event_end, $this_time_arr[($event_length[$i]['key'])], '', 0, '<font class="eventfont">', '</font>', 'psf', $event_url);
  												  echo '</td></tr>'."\n";
  												  echo '</table>'."\n";
Index: month.php
===================================================================
RCS file: /cvsroot/phpicalendar/phpicalendar/month.php,v
retrieving revision 1.102
retrieving revision 1.103
diff -C2 -d -r1.102 -r1.103
*** month.php	19 Nov 2003 07:54:09 -0000	1.102
--- month.php	20 Nov 2003 05:18:38 -0000	1.103
***************
*** 115,120 ****
  									foreach ($event_times as $val) {
  										$num_of_events2++;
! 										$event_calno = $val['calnumber'];
! 										$event_calna = $val['calname'];
  										if (!isset($val["event_start"])) {
  											echo '<div align="center" class="V10">';
--- 115,121 ----
  									foreach ($event_times as $val) {
  										$num_of_events2++;
! 										$event_calno 	= $val['calnumber'];
! 										$event_calna 	= $val['calname'];
! 										$event_url 		= $val['url'];
  										if (!isset($val["event_start"])) {
  											echo '<div align="center" class="V10">';
***************
*** 123,127 ****
  											"<i>",
  											"</i>",
! 											"psf");
  											echo '</div>';
  										} else {	
--- 124,129 ----
  											"<i>",
  											"</i>",
! 											"psf",
! 											$event_url);
  											echo '</div>';
  										} else {	
***************
*** 141,145 ****
  											"$start2 ",
  											"",
! 											"ps3");
  											echo '</div>';
  										}
--- 143,148 ----
  											"$start2 ",
  											"",
! 											"ps3",
! 											$event_url);
  											echo '</div>';
  										}
***************
*** 197,202 ****
  								// Pull out each time
  								foreach ($new_val as $new_key2 => $new_val2) {
! 								$event_calno = $new_val2['calnumber'];
! 								$event_calna = $new_val2['calname'];
  
  								if ($new_val2["event_text"]) {	
--- 200,206 ----
  								// Pull out each time
  								foreach ($new_val as $new_key2 => $new_val2) {
! 								$event_calno 	= $new_val2['calnumber'];
! 								$event_calna 	= $new_val2['calname'];
! 								$event_url 		= $new_val2['url'];
  
  								if ($new_val2["event_text"]) {	
***************
*** 229,233 ****
  									"<font class=\"G10B\">",
  									"</font>",
! 									"psf");
  									echo "</td>\n";
  									echo "</tr>\n";
--- 233,238 ----
  									"<font class=\"G10B\">",
  									"</font>",
! 									"psf",
! 									$event_url);
  									echo "</td>\n";
  									echo "</tr>\n";
Index: week.php
===================================================================
RCS file: /cvsroot/phpicalendar/phpicalendar/week.php,v
retrieving revision 1.102
retrieving revision 1.103
diff -C2 -d -r1.102 -r1.103
*** week.php	19 Nov 2003 07:54:09 -0000	1.102
--- week.php	20 Nov 2003 05:18:38 -0000	1.103
***************
*** 165,168 ****
--- 165,169 ----
  														$event_calno  = $allday['calnumber'];
  														$event_calna  = $allday['calname'];
+ 														$event_url    = $allday['url'];
  						 								if ($event_calno < 1) $event_calno=1;
  														if ($event_calno > 7) $event_calno=7;
***************
*** 176,180 ****
  													  	'<font color="#ffffff">',
  													  	"</font>",
! 													  	"psf");
  														echo "</td></tr>\n";
  												  	}
--- 177,182 ----
  													  	'<font color="#ffffff">',
  													  	"</font>",
! 													  	"psf",
! 													  	$event_url);
  														echo "</td></tr>\n";
  												  	}
***************
*** 186,192 ****
  											  } while ($i < 7);
  											echo "</tr>\n";
! 										}
! 											// $master_array[($getdate)]["$day_time"]
! 											
  											$thisdate = $start_week_time;
  											for ($i=0;$i<7;$i++) {
--- 188,192 ----
  											  } while ($i < 7);
  											echo "</tr>\n";
! 										}											
  											$thisdate = $start_week_time;
  											for ($i=0;$i<7;$i++) {
***************
*** 309,313 ****
  																	$event_end 	= date ($timeFormat, $event_end);
  
! 																	$event_calna = $this_time_arr[($event_length[$thisday][$i]["key"])]['calname'];
  																	openevent("$event_calna",
  																		  "$event_start",
--- 309,314 ----
  																	$event_end 	= date ($timeFormat, $event_end);
  
! 																	$event_calna 	= $this_time_arr[($event_length[$thisday][$i]["key"])]['calname'];
! 																	$event_url 		= $this_time_arr[($event_length[$thisday][$i]["key"])]['url'];
  																	openevent("$event_calna",
  																		  "$event_start",
***************
*** 318,322 ****
  																		  "<font class=\"V10W\">",
  																		  "</font>",
! 																		  "psf");
  																	echo "</td></tr>\n";
  																	echo "</table>\n";
--- 319,324 ----
  																		  "<font class=\"V10W\">",
  																		  "</font>",
! 																		  "psf",
! 																		  $event_url);
  																	echo "</td></tr>\n";
  																	echo "</table>\n";
 |